Skip to content
本页目录

wps中台多环境使用部署说明

说明

mas5.11之前平台接口需要不登录就能访问需要在mas-gateway中调整参数值方式进行设置,调整后mas-gateway服务就需要重启会影响系统使用;现在可以通过lc-apiacm应用来管理放行接口

需要在管理站点安装并授权lc-apiacm应用

##步骤:

1、上架lc-apiacm应用,并授权到站点,并将菜单加到导航

2、进入菜单新增/编辑需要放行的接口

1.png

2.png

类型如何选?

通常类型应该选择根据path

根据uuid这种类型是低代码中某个接口上设置了匿名访问会自动添加到白名单,因为低代码分为项目和应用模式且接口带有版本需通过唯一标识(uuid)来识别

注意低代码开发的应用上架使用如果有匿名接口,需要在开发环境中找到uuid并维护进生产环境的访问控制白名单表中

含有匿名接口低代码应用上架到生产环境时需要从开发环境中将其接口的uuid查到

然后在平台管理的lc-apiacm应用中选择uuid类型,模块:locas-service,将放行的接口uuid加入并刷新缓存生效

select DISTINCT c_uuid from #tablename where c_tenant_id = ? and c_project= ?

  • 其中#tablename需要替换为:cos_groovy_service 、cos_service_engine_service、 cos_system_service、 cos_sql_service、 cos_third_service、 cos_system_service_interface

  • ? 分别替换为租户id和项目标识

3、刷新缓存使变更生效

3.png

内部资料,请勿外传